Can anyone relate?

So I am very sensitive to stimuli, of all kinds. And when I'm doing anything that I enjoy I find the need to dampen my other senses to focus on the sensations in that moment. In terms of cuddling, that means that, 90% of the time I'm cuddling my eyes will be closed. I also don't usually put music on and while I don't mind talking if I'm cuddling for myself at some point I'll stop talking. It helps me to focus on all the wonderful sensations of warmth and touch happening.

I'm just curious if anyone else is similar to me lol I tend to find men I'm cuddling with looking at my face and I always have to explain. I don't want them to think I don't want to look at them hahah
